Trump ally Mike Lee rails against Netflix-Warner Bros. merger

Published January 27, 2026 3:08pm ET



Sen. Mike Lee (R-UT), who chairs the Senate Judiciary Committee’s antitrust subcommittee, is leading the growing Republican opposition to the proposed merger between Netflix and Warner Bros. Discovery.

Lee’s concerns about the antitrust implications of the pending purchase, should it proceed, underscore the importance of the regulatory approval process in this case.
